What is a 30A Power Relay?
A power relay is an electromechanical switch that uses an electromagnet to open or close a set of electrical contacts. The 30A Power Relay is designed to handle high current, typically rated for 30 amps, which is quite substantial compared to standard relays. It can control heavy-duty electrical devices or circuits that require significant power to function, such as motors, heating elements, and large lighting systems.
The relay consists of several parts, including a coil, contacts, a spring mechanism, and an armature. When an electrical current flows through the coil, it generates a magnetic field, causing the armature to move and either open or close the contacts. This action allows the relay to control a high-power circuit using a much lower control voltage.
